Caffeine Content in Common Drinks
DrinkTypical ServingCaffeine
Drip coffee8 oz (240ml)~95 mg
Espresso1 shot (30ml)~63 mg
Instant coffee8 oz (240ml)~62 mg
Black tea8 oz (240ml)~47 mg
Green tea8 oz (240ml)~28 mg
Cola (regular)12 oz can (355ml)~34 mg
Energy drink8 oz (240ml)~80 mg
Dark chocolate1 oz (28g)~12 mg

Values vary by brand and brewing method — check packaging for exact amounts where available.

How Long Does Caffeine Actually Stay In Your System?

The average half-life of caffeine — the time it takes your body to clear half of what you consumed — is about 5 hours in healthy adults, though it genuinely ranges from roughly 1.5 to 9.5 hours depending on your genetics, smoking status, pregnancy, and medications. Full elimination from your system takes 5-6 half-lives, or roughly 24-30 hours for most people. Why Caffeine Half-Life Varies So Much Between People

🧬 Genetics (CYP1A2)

A liver enzyme called CYP1A2 does most of the work breaking down caffeine. Genetic variation in this enzyme is the single biggest reason some people are "fast metabolizers" and others are "slow metabolizers" of caffeine.

🚬 Smoking

Smoking tobacco significantly speeds up caffeine metabolism — roughly cutting the half-life in half — which is one reason smokers often report needing caffeine more frequently throughout the day.

🤰 Pregnancy

Caffeine half-life extends substantially during pregnancy, especially in the third trimester, sometimes reaching 10-20 hours — a major reason pregnancy caffeine guidelines are notably stricter than general adult guidance.

💊 Oral Contraceptives

Hormonal birth control can extend caffeine's half-life by roughly 50-100%, meaning caffeine may stay active in your system considerably longer than the average 5-hour estimate.

Caffeine and Sleep: What the Research Actually Shows

A frequently cited 2013 study published in the Journal of Clinical Sleep Medicine, led by Drake and colleagues, tested caffeine consumption at 0, 3, and 6 hours before bedtime. Even caffeine taken a full 6 hours before bed meaningfully reduced total sleep time — by more than an hour in the study — despite participants not necessarily feeling like caffeine was "still active." This finding challenges the common assumption that caffeine only matters if consumed shortly before sleep; its effects on sleep architecture can persist well beyond when the alertness-boosting feeling has faded.

Caffeine works by blocking adenosine receptors in the brain — adenosine is a chemical that naturally builds up throughout the day and promotes sleepiness. By blocking these receptors, caffeine masks your body's natural sleep pressure, which is why you can feel alert even when your body's underlying sleep drive is actually building normally underneath the caffeine's effects. Many sleep researchers suggest aiming to have less than 25mg of caffeine remaining in your system by bedtime, which is the threshold this tracker's decay chart highlights.

Daily Caffeine Limits: US, EU, and UK Guidelines

  • FDA (United States): Up to 400mg per day is generally considered safe for most healthy adults — roughly 4 cups of brewed coffee
  • EFSA (Europe): Also cites 400mg/day for adults, with a lower limit of 3mg/kg body weight for children and adolescents
  • NHS (UK): Recommends pregnant women limit caffeine to 200mg per day, roughly half the general adult guideline, due to caffeine's extended half-life and placental transfer during pregnancy
  • Adolescents: Generally advised to stay under 100mg per day across most guidance, given lower body weight and developing systems

It's worth noting that a flat daily limit doesn't account for body weight — some researchers and clinicians instead reference a dose of roughly 4-6mg per kg of body weight as an upper threshold, meaning the same 400mg dose represents a much larger relative dose for a 50kg adult than a 90kg adult.

Practical Tips for Better Caffeine Timing

  • Set a personal "caffeine curfew" — based on the Drake et al. research, many people benefit from stopping caffeine 6-8 hours before bedtime
  • Watch hidden sources — chocolate, some pain relievers, and pre-workout supplements often contain meaningful caffeine that's easy to forget when tallying your daily total
  • Consider your afternoon slump differently — reaching for caffeine to fix a 3pm energy dip can create a cycle that disrupts that night's sleep, worsening the next day's slump
  • If you're a slow metabolizer, adjust earlier — genetics, pregnancy, or certain medications can mean your personal "safe cutoff" time needs to be earlier than generic advice suggests
  • Track patterns, not just single days — if you regularly feel groggy or have trouble falling asleep, logging a few days of intake and timing can reveal patterns you might otherwise miss
